Capcom has realised this gaming market and are set to release Capcom Classics Collection Reloaded on the PSP which is comprised of a nice bundle of Capcom goodies for gamers to poke their gaming minds at.
Some titles that are included in this compilation includes the original Street Fighter II Championship and Hyper edition, Ghouls and Ghosts and a range of battle games which reminds me of the turn based worms games. Along the way, gamers will also be able to unlock extra Capcom classics which can be purchased by using coins that are won during the game. I find this to be a nice little inclusion which will keep players hooked on these mini games until they unlock all the classics.
